The Geograph project started in 2005 with the aim of publishing, organising and preserving representative images for every square kilometre of Great Britain, Ireland and the Isle of Man.

While the steep slopes of the Wye Valley carry some fine oak woods, the plateau wood called The Oaks is mostly coniferous.
